Investment Rotation Techniques Leveraging S&P 500 Sector ETFs for Returns

Navigating the dynamic landscape of the stock market often demands a strategic approach. One such strategy is sector rotation, which entails repositioning investments among various sectors of the economy based on their performance. By utilizing S&P 500 sector ETFs, investors can efficiently implement this strategic approach and potentially enhance returns.

  • Additionally, sector rotation allows investors to exploit the cyclical nature of different industries.
  • Specifically, during periods of economic growth, sectors such as consumer discretionary and industrials may excel others. Conversely, in a declining environment, defensive sectors like healthcare and utilities might withstand volatility.
  • Consequently, by rotating investments between these sectors, investors can potentially mitigate risk and enhance portfolio returns over the long term.
